Analysis of Clinical Features of Mammary Analog Secretory Carcinoma Using the Surveillance, Epidemiology, and End Results Database

JAMA Otolaryngol Head Neck Surg. 2019 Jan 1;145(1):91-93. doi: 10.1001/jamaoto.2018.2936.

Abstract

This population-based study uses data from the Surveillance, Epidemiology, and End Results database to analyze the typical clinical characteristics of mammary analog secretory carcinoma.
